We're just about to sign Vicente from Valencia, 'The Dagger of Benicalap', on a FREE transfer too. He was one of the best players in the world a few years ago, won La Liga and the UEFA Cup with Valencia, scoring a penalty in the final in 2004. Since then niggling injuries have held him back a bit, but he's still only 30 and if we do land him, it will be one hell of a signing for this little club to make. He was spotted in a restaurant in Hove yesterday with our manager Gus Poyet, and is staying another night in a hotel here. Hopefully the pen will be out and we have him on a three year contract.

Amazing things happening at the club right right now, a brand new 22,500 capacity stadium, with more seats going in soon to make it 30,000. Having never spent more than £500,000 on any player previous, this summer we broke the £1million mark twice, then signed a striker from under the noses of West Ham and moneybags Leicester, spending £2.5million. Unbelievable really, now we've almost got Vicente and are sitting pretty at the top of the league.
In 1997 we were bottom of the whole football league, our ground was sold off, we were one goal away from oblivion at Hereford, where if we'd dropped into the little leagues the club would have folded forever.
